2023-Application Integration Specialist-PACT


Job Description

Application Integration Specialist

Location: Madrid, Spain                                         


Kearney and PACT (People at the Core of Transformation)

Kearney is a leading global management consulting firm with offices in more than 40 countries. Since 1926, we have been trusted advisors to the world’s foremost organizations. Kearney is a partner-owned firm, committed to helping clients achieve success. We understand our people and our former employees as a key asset for the future success of the firm.


PACT is Kearney’s digital solution to enable end-to-end workforce transformation – consolidating all client people data into one platform to drive immediate insights. PACT helps leaders answer the critical people questions needed to transform their organization. PACT can currently provide:

·       FOUNDATION data for the client to understand the cost and profile of their workforce

·    SIGNAL information when benchmarks are drawn in and compared to client data to give indications of potential areas of improvement

·       DIAGNOSE activities to survey either competency levels or functional task mapping

·       PLAN forecasts to interrogate historical demand and project future workforce needs

·       DESIGN functionality to visualize organisational charts and interactively build future scenarios

·     TRANSITION monitoring to understand personnel fit to new roles, and track the fulfilment of people placement during a re-structuring

·       SUSTAIN highlights, analyzing change statistics to pinpoint areas where further activation training or events are required 

What we seek

Kearney is seeking a skilled and experienced Application Integration Specialist to join our PACT team. As an Application Integration Specialist, you will be responsible for designing, implementing, and maintaining seamless integration solutions between various software applications and systems within our organization. Your expertise in middleware technologies, data mapping, and API management will be critical to ensuring efficient data exchange and process automation.


Functions and Responsibilities:

·    Integration Strategy: develop and execute a comprehensive application integration strategy, aligning with business requirements and objectives. Identify integration opportunities to optimize data flow and enhance business processes.

·    Middleware Implementation: design and implement middleware solutions for connecting disparate applications and systems. Leverage integration platforms, such as ESB (Enterprise Service Bus) or iPaaS (Integration Platform as a Service), to facilitate smooth communication and data exchange.

·      API Management: establish and manage APIs (Application Programming Interfaces) to enable seamless integration and interactions between applications. Ensure security, authentication, and access control measures are in place.

·     Data Mapping and Transformation: define data mapping rules and transformations between different data formats to enable accurate data exchange and synchronization across applications.

·    Troubleshooting and Support: provide technical support and troubleshooting expertise for integration-related issues. Collaborate with developers and stakeholders to diagnose and resolve integration challenges.

·      Integration Testing: conduct thorough testing of integration solutions to validate functionality, data accuracy, and system performance. Implement automated testing processes for regression testing.

·    Documentation: create detailed technical documentation, including integration specifications, configuration guides, and operational procedures.

·    Collaboration: work closely with cross-functional teams, including software developers, business analysts, and system administrators, to ensure successful integration of applications and alignment with business needs.

·      Performance Optimization: continuously monitor and optimize integration processes to improve efficiency, scalability, and reliability.

·     Stay Current with Technology Trends: keep abreast of emerging technologies and best practices in application integration. Recommend and implement innovative solutions to enhance integration capabilities.

The following qualifications are preferred:  

·       Bachelor’s degree in computer science, Information Technology, or a related field

·       Proven experience (5 years) as an Application Integration Specialist and programming languages such as HTML, CSS, View JS, Go JS, Python and Flask Framework

·       Strong knowledge of middleware technologies, such as ESB, iPaaS, or API management platforms

·       Proficiency in data mapping and transformation techniques

·       Experience with integration tools and technologies, such as MuleSoft, Dell Boomi, IBM Integration Bus, etc.

·       Familiarity with various data exchange protocols, such as REST, SOAP, JSON, and XML

·       Strong problem-solving skills and ability to troubleshoot complex integration issues

·       Excellent communication and interpersonal skills to collaborate effectively with cross-functional teams

·       Detail-oriented with a focus on delivering high-quality integration solutions

·       Experience with cloud-based integration solutions (e.g., AWS, Azure, Google Cloud)

·     Knowledge of enterprise systems, ERP (Enterprise Resource Planning), and CRM (Customer Relationship Management) applications

·       Knowledge on Gen AI, NLP, ML is a plus

Language Requirements